         <title>Mansa Musa, ruler of Mali from 1312 to 1337, went on pilgramage to Mecca. Upon his return to Mali, he took the Islamic religion more seriously and made Islam better known in the Mali empire. This included religious schools and bringing in Arabian and north African teachers, including four of Muhammad&#39;s descendants.</title>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>East African trade concentrated into several port cities that grew in population as more people settled in them, thus relying more on agriculture. Architecture advanced from wood and mud materials to large buildings constructed out of coral <br><br></div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Nobles in east Africa began to adopt Islam as their religion of choice. Even though they were now Islamic, they didn't give up their original cultural and religious traditions for the sake of providing leadership to their societies. The ruling elites converting to Islam had also gained legitimacy&nbsp;in the eyes of Islamic states  in southwest Asia.</div>]]></description>
